Output 289e33e7bf794490dde31841bf352e55347aa294a213310945f55ea541a21e1a:8

value
26390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dd476089c1692fade314c3be8c4c02ee462d142 OP_EQUAL
address
35sLrEHvLpbuTc2S2Go26DJBtKnZCvDJsA
transaction
289e33e7bf794490dde31841bf352e55347aa294a213310945f55ea541a21e1a
spent
true